what is the way to find out user exits?
Answers were Sorted based on User's Feedback
Answer / swamy
1.goto tcode se93
2.double click on program
3.goto attributes
4.take the packge name
5.goto smod and click on f4
6.give the package name and execute
7.display the required user exit.
8.and goto cmod and developed

Answer / babita
Enter the tcode for which u want to know about user exits.
use menu SYSTEM->STATUS.
click on program name.
GOTO-> OBJECT DIRECTORY ENTRY.
get the PACKAGE name.
enter tcode smod
give the package neme
u'll get list of all user exits related to that particular
tcode

Answer / syamala
1) Execute Tcode SPRO
2) Click on SAP Reference IMG
3) Expand Sales and Distribution
4) Expand System Modifications
5) Expand Userexits
6) Expand Userexits in sales
7) Click on Documentation of Userexits in sales document processing
8) Read the documentation and identify the Userexit
